Abstract
本实用新型涉及一种大棚种植技术,尤其是一种循环多功能温室大棚。该大棚包括大棚本体,其中,所述大棚本体内设有热泵,大棚本体的下方土壤内设有沼气池和蓄水池,沼气池内设有沼气罐和环绕在沼气罐外部的热水盘管,沼气罐的外部填充有保温层,蓄水池内设有蓄热水箱,蓄热水箱的外部填充有保温层,蓄热水箱设有三套循环水管,其中第一套循环水管与大棚内的散热装置连接,第二套循环水管的进水口与热泵的出水口连通,出水口与热泵的进水口连通,第三套循环水管的进水口与热水盘管的出水口连通,出水口与热水盘管的进水口连通,沼气罐的出气口与沼气灯连接,沼气灯固定设置在大棚内,大棚本体的顶部设有补光灯。
The utility model relates to a greenhouse planting technology, in particular to a circular multifunctional greenhouse. The greenhouse includes a greenhouse body, wherein a heat pump is arranged in the greenhouse body, a biogas tank and a water storage tank are arranged in the soil below the greenhouse body, and a biogas tank and a hot water coil surrounding the outside of the biogas tank are arranged in the biogas tank. The exterior of the biogas tank is filled with an insulation layer, the reservoir is equipped with a heat storage tank, the exterior of the heat storage tank is filled with an insulation layer, and the heat storage tank is equipped with three sets of circulating water pipes, of which the first set of circulating water pipes is the same as the The water inlet of the second set of circulating water pipes is connected with the water outlet of the heat pump, the water outlet is connected with the water inlet of the heat pump, the water inlet of the third set of circulating water pipes is connected with the water outlet of the hot water coil, and the water outlet is connected with the heat pump The water inlet of the water coil is connected, the gas outlet of the biogas tank is connected with the biogas lamp, the biogas lamp is fixedly arranged in the greenhouse, and the top of the greenhouse body is provided with a supplementary light.
